As in the title. I had ubuntu installed on this machine before and did not run into any trouble, but having windows 10 installed in between seems to have caused the trouble. The screen is black as in black is being displayed, rather than no signal coming through the cable, given that the light on the monitor didn't turn orange. So far I've tried flashing the bios to the latest version and reseting the CMOS, both by bridging the pins and by removing the battery, but nothing.

Also setting 'splash quiet' to 'nomodeset' doesn't seem to help either. And there is no secure boot option in the bios settings. ( Gigabyte F2A55M-HD2 Rev. 1)

I can successfully boot the rescue CD software from the same USB stick, so I don't think it's the GRUB loader...
